Our large manufacturing client located in Peoria, Illinois, is looking for a Tool Designer, to add to their team.

Job Description

Depending on experience, responsibilities include:

Review manufacturing information (e.g., process routing, 3D model, workholding) of new or existing parts, as applicable, to ensure proper development or update of tool design documentation and set up of part (s) for manufacturing

Evaluate and design workholding as needed to manufacture part(s) in selected machines

Create new or modify existing 3D Models and 2D Prints of selected workholding utilizing CAD software.

Properly set up workholding documentation in manufacturing systems as per Standard Processes

Create new or modify existing 3D Models and 2D Prints of selected cutting assemblies, tool components and manufacturing engineering models as needed

Properly set up documentation in manufacturing systems as per Standard Processes Update machine tool models according to specification.

Modify and troubleshoot models to ensure accurate design

Create machining/assembly layouts for manufacturing

Assist with any tool design inquiry, issue, or concern on a promptly matter to ensure manufacturing of parts to specification

Provide shop support as needed for tool design inquiries

Participate of engineering team meetings, and collaborate as needed

Identify opportunities for tool design optimization and cost reduction

Work with cross-functional teams, Manufacturing Engineers, Quality Engineers & Operations Leaders on assigned projects or activities

Manage multiple projects, prioritize requests and meet timelines

REQUIREMENTS

Bachelor or Associate's degree in Manufacturing Engineering or similar field is preferred

Strong knowledge in manufacturing, specially machining processes such as turning, milling, drilling and tapping is required

At least two years of work experience on fixture/tool design, 3D modeling and 2D drawing, is required

Must have experience in 3D/2D CAD/CAM systems. NX and Creo/Pro-E preferred Ability to read blueprints is a must.

Ability to handle multiple projects and to meet deadlines is required

Strong written and verbal communication skills are required

Ability to read and understand regulations and procedures is required
